Ok so my computer(A partitioned macbook pro) recently acquired a virus. The said virus, named "Win 7 Security 2012", has completely disabled my windows side of my computer. Rendering me unable to do just about anything on it. I am wondering if anyone has any ideas on how to get rid of it? I have read about deleting Registry Keys, but I have no idea how to do that. I hate to admit it, but I am completely naive about how computers. All I know is when I try to open up the regedit, or command prompt, the virus makes me unable to open it. I have also tried backing my computer up to a recent time, but it appears that the only time, backs up to a time that is already infected. I would hate to lose all my shit over this..
Any attempted virus surgery should be done in safe mode. You should be able to open regedit from there and get rid of it. Make sure you identify the virus and google removal instructions, find all relevant files and registry keys that point to them, and nuke it. If you can't figure it out you need to backup whatever data you can in safe mode and format the drive, which is the safest thing to do anyway.
